Some insects hibernate in the soil or trash around plants or lay eggs in or on the host plant. Do not expand the exact same kind of veggie in the same area annually (Figure 84). Use related crops in a site just when every three or four years. The turning period for staying clear of some tomato illness may be 5 to seven years.


Plant turning is most effective on bugs that develop on a few plants. Stay clear of putting all plants of one kind with each other; instead spread them throughout the garden (Number 85). Take into consideration alternating teams of different plants within rows or spots. Bugs that become severe on cabbage probably likewise infest nearby mustard, broccoli, as well as collards, however they might not spread to cabbage planted beyond of the yard.


Marigolds and garlic are two plants recommended as insect repellants; nonetheless, many of these referrals are unproven. In some cases, the evidence shows these plants are not efficient repellants.


The flowers of thistle, plantain, knotweed, as well as dandelion are essential to honey bee populations. Getting rid of weeds after flowering but before seed set provides food for the honey bees yet keeps the weeds from proceeding to spread. An additional method to manage insect bugs is to grow a crop that is really appealing to bugs and after that deal with the catch plant with pesticide.

Crop rotation is a beneficial cultural approach for decreasing bug and also illness concerns, however several gardeners do not have the room to completely execute this technique. Where area is limited, it might be best to permit the yard to lay fallow for a year or more or more. Think about increased beds with brand-new dirt or plant in containers when you recognize a disease issue exists.




Almost any type of huge non-venomous insect can be selected off at any phase. To stay clear of the job of hand-squashing the insects, knock the insects and also egg clusters right into a coffee can or quart jar with a percentage of water as well as a bit of meal detergent. Insect catches can aid with detection and administration.

Reapply every one to 3 weeks. This obstacle is preventive; it will not function if an insect parasite is already developed.


Some parasites, such as the azalea stem borer and the dogwood club gall (Figure 813), can be handled by trimming contaminated branches out of plagued plants and ruining them. If twigs infested with dogwood branch borers are trimmed in late spring or early summertime, the plants must still bloom with no trouble the complying with springtime.


Once plant damage is seen, it may be as well late for handpicking to be reliable. Proactively you can try this out monitoring the crops and looking for the initial indicators of damage maintains the insect populations at a level that permits handpicking to be successful.


The best single consider maintaining plant-feeding insects from overwhelming the rest of the globe is that they are food for other bugs. Bug and mite populaces are generally reasonably concentrated. Therefore, one or two grass in an area might have generous numbers of millipedes or eco-friendly June beetle grubs while a lawn 2 houses away may have nearly none.
